The Ants of Central and Northern Europe

Description:
Text English. Originally published in German, this book is now available in a significantly enlarged English edition, describing 190 species (compared to 121 in the original German edition). The book also contains: an introduction to morphology, development, ecology, life cycle, feeding strategies and enemies of ants; comprehensive information on all important aspects of the special biology of the 180 outdoor species of Central and North Europe given in a standardized handbook format; a short description of the multidimensional niche space of all German ants; an illustrated identification key to all 190 species recorded for the area and neighbouring regions; the author's position on some fundamental questions of taxonomy and biodiversity research; col photos and line drawings of living or mounted ants.
